Brewers to conduct lottery for individual postseason tickets
Published September 4, 2008 - BizTimes Daily
The Milwaukee Brewers today announced details for a postseason lottery that will give fans an opportunity to register for the right to purchase tickets to individual 2008 playoff games to be held at Miller Park.
In addition, season seatholders who currently have their postseason order forms are reminded that Friday is the deadline for payment of 2008 postseason tickets.
Fans interested in registering for the postseason lottery should go to www.brewers.com and look for the link to "Postseason Ticket Opportunity." With inventory expected to be very limited, it is likely that only a limited number of fans will be selected to purchase tickets through the lottery.
Registration for the postseason ticket opportunities will begin at noon (Central Time) on Friday and will close at noon on Wednesday, Sept. 17.
The Brewers will conduct a random selection of winners from the pool of registrants for each of the three postseason series. The N.L. Division Series (NLDS) winners will be selected on or around Thursday, Sept. 18, and will have the opportunity to purchase up to four tickets to one game of the 2008 NLDS.
Winners for N.L. Championship Series and World Series drawings will be selected from the same of pool registrants at later dates. Registrants (including winners of previous drawings) will be eligible for each drawing.
There is no charge to register for the opportunity. Additional rules and information are available at www.brewers.com.
The team said 2008 postseason tickets also may be secured by placing deposits on 2009 full season ticket plans.
